Inc. - JMB Mechanical Inc. - Products/Services Requested: - One 36,000 BTU heat pump system (compressor) - Three wall-mounted heat pump heads - Two thermostats/controllers - Removal and disposal of the old mini split system - Hourly rates for additional maintenance and two scheduled maintenance visits - Key Requirements: - Heat pump system must be a name brand (LG, Samsung, Mitsubishi, etc.) with a SEER rating of 20 or higher - One-year craftsmanship warranty required - Compliance with prevailing wage laws and certified payrolls - 5% bid bond required - Physical bid submission - Job-walk visit recommended - All work to be performed at the Newport Police Department - Place of Performance and Delivery: - Newport Police Department, Newport, RI - Purchasing Office, City Hall, 43 Broadway, Newport, RI (contracting office) - The opportunity is open to all qualified vendors and is not a piggyback contract.
Description
The City of Newport is soliciting sealed bids for the replacement of a mini split HVAC system at the Newport Police Department. The project requires compliance with specified terms including prevailing wage laws and insurance requirements. A job-walk visit is scheduled to familiarize bidders with the site. Bids must be physically submitted by the specified deadline and include required documentation such as bid bonds and certified payrolls for construction services.
